How to Assign an IP Address on Windows 10?

In this article, we will discuss the process of setting up an IP address on Windows 10. IP addresses are essential for connecting to the internet and communicating with other devices on the same network. We will provide step-by-step instructions on how to set up an IP address on Windows 10.

Step 1: Open the Network Connections Window

The first step in setting up an IP address on Windows 10 is to open the Network Connections window. To do this, go to the Start menu and select Settings. In the Settings window, go to the Network & Internet tab and select Status. In the Status window, click the Network Connections link.

Step 2: Choose the Network Adapter

Once the Network Connections window is open, select the network adapter that you want to assign an IP address to. For example, if you are connecting to an Ethernet network, select the Ethernet adapter.

Step 3: Assign the IP Address

Now that you have selected the network adapter, right-click it and select Properties. In the Properties window, select the Internet Protocol Version 4 (TCP/IPv4) option and click the Properties button. In the Internet Protocol Version 4 (TCP/IPv4) Properties window, select the Use the following IP address option. Now you can enter the IP address that you want to assign to the network adapter.

Step 4: Set the DNS Server Addresses

The next step is to set the DNS server addresses. To do this, select the Use the following DNS server addresses option and enter the DNS server addresses that you want to use.

Step 5: Save the Changes

Once you have entered the IP address and DNS server addresses, click OK to save the changes. Your IP address is now set and you can connect to the internet or other devices on the same network.

Step 6: Verify the IP Address

The last step is to verify that the IP address is set correctly. To do this, go to the Start menu and select Command Prompt. In the Command Prompt window, type “ipconfig” and press Enter. This will show you the IP address that is assigned to the network adapter.

What is an IP Address?

An IP address (Internet Protocol address) is a numerical label assigned to each device (e.g., computer, printer) connected to a computer network that uses the Internet Protocol for communication. An IP address serves two primary functions: host or network interface identification and location addressing. The IP address lets other network devices know where to send data when communicating over the internet.

How Do I Find My IP Address on Windows 10?

To find your IP address on Windows 10, go to the Start menu and type “cmd” in the search box. The Command Prompt window will open. Type “ipconfig” and press Enter. Your IP address will be displayed next to “IPv4 Address”. You can also find your IP address by opening the Settings app and going to Network & Internet > Status.

How Do I Set a Static IP Address in Windows 10?

To set a static IP address in Windows 10, open the Start menu and type “network connections” in the search box. Select “Change adapter settings” and then select the adapter to configure. Right-click and select “Properties”, select “Internet Protocol Version 4 (TCP/IPv4)” from the list, and then select “Properties” again. Select “Use the following IP address” and enter the desired IP address, subnet mask, and default gateway. Click “OK” to save the changes.

How Do I Release and Renew an IP Address in Windows 10?

To release and renew an IP address in Windows 10, open the Start menu and type “cmd” in the search box. The Command Prompt window will open. Type “ipconfig /release” and press Enter. Then type “ipconfig /renew” and press Enter. The IP address will be renewed. You can also use the “ipconfig /flushdns” command to flush the DNS cache.
